The 24-year-old`s initial month-long stay at Pride Park ended following the Championship defeat at Millwall last weekend.
Derby agreed a deal in principle to extend Moore`s loan prior to the game against the Lions. That has now been finalised and the player will remain with Nigel Clough`s side until November 20.
"I am delighted to extend my stay because I have really enjoyed it at Derby," Moore told the club`s official website.
"It has ben perfect coming here. I have played some games and got my name on the scoresheet as well so I hope the second month goes well too."
Moore has scored one goal in six appearances for the Rams, opening the scoring in a 3-2 victory at Doncaster 10 days ago.
